Scolibrace for Teens • #scolibraceprovider #scolibrace #bethesdaspineandposture • The ScoliBrace is a type of custom-fitted scoliosis brace designed to help manage and correct spinal curvature in individuals, including teens, who have scoliosis. Here’s how it can help a teen: • 1. **Slows or Stops Curve Progression**: The brace can prevent further progression of the spinal curve, especially during periods of rapid growth in adolescence when scoliosis tends to worsen. • 2. **Supports Improved Posture**: By realigning the spine and torso, the ScoliBrace can help the teen maintain a better posture, potentially reducing discomfort or pain caused by uneven weight distribution. • 3. **Non-Surgical Treatment**: For teens with mild to moderate scoliosis, wearing the brace can be an effective non-surgical option, potentially avoiding or delaying the need for surgery if it is successful in controlling the curve progression. • 4. **Custom Fit and Comfort**: ScoliBrace is custom-made for each patient, which increases its effectiveness and comfort. It is designed to be worn under clothing and allows for more normal movement, which can make it easier for teens to incorporate it into daily life. • 5. **Improves Confidence**: Managing scoliosis with a brace can improve self-esteem and confidence, as it helps reduce visible spinal curvature and promotes a healthier appearance, which can be important for teens during a vulnerable time of physical and emotional development. • 6. **Long-Term Health Benefits**: Using the brace as prescribed can help prevent future complications from scoliosis, such as chronic back pain, respiratory issues, or physical limitations. • Ultimately, the effectiveness of the ScoliBrace depends on wearing it as recommended by a healthcare professional and the severity of the scoliosis.
